The Mandell Place Civic Association will hold a general meeting Monday September 13th at 7:00p. The meeting will be held at the Bering Church Room 108-A. Officer Wayne Pate from the Montrose HPD storefront will be on hand to discuss security in our neighborhood. Everyone is encouraged to attend in a unified effort to keep crime out of Mandell Place.
The second half of the meeting, expected to last an hour, will include a discussion of our existing deed restrictions and proposed additions to preserve the residential integrity of our neighborhood. The board will present considerations for side setbacks, rear setbacks, height restrictions, front yard fence standards, number of units per lot and making the minimum lot size permanent. Your ideas and input and encouraged in an effort to maintain the charm of our neighborhood.

There will be road resurfacing petitions at the social. Stop by and sign the petition for your block to be repaved. Petitions require 75% of the owners on each block to sign for submission to the City of Houston Public Works Department. Let’s set the wheels in motion to improve our streets.

2009 National Night Out is the 26th anniversary of a campaign involving citizens, law enforcement, civic groups, businesses and local officials in an effort to: heighten crime prevention; generate interest and partcipation in anticrime programs; strengthen neighborhood spirit and police-community partnerships; and send a message to criminals that our neighborhood is organized.

Election of the Mandell Place Board of Directors will be held in November. Board member positions are president, vice president, treasurer and secretary. Candidates are nominated through a committee organized in October. If you would like to participate in the nominating committee, contact a current member of the MPCA board or sign up at the 10/06/2009 National Night Out meeting at 1504 Harold from 6-8 pm. Nominations are also accepted from the floor at the general election in November. Residents of MPCA must be current on membership dues in order to run for a board position or vote in the election. 2009 dues are accepted up to the time of the election.
